Can You Use Apple CarPlay with an iPad?
A question that often pops up is whether or not you can utilize Apple CarPlay with an iPad. The simple answer is no. CarPlay is specifically designed to integrate with vehicles, leveraging the car's existing dashboard display. An iPad, while a powerful device, lacks the necessary hardware to interface directly with a vehicle.
- There are some third-party apps that try to mimic CarPlay's functionality on iPads, but these often have limitations and may not provide the full features.

Apple CarPlay Compatibility with iPad: What You Need to Know
While Apple CarPlay has revolutionized the in-car interface, many users wonder if it's compatible with iPads. Unfortunately, as of now, Apple hasn't officially released a way to use CarPlay directly on an iPad.
The system is developed specifically for navigation systems within vehicles. However, there are some workarounds and possibilities you can explore.
- Consider using a dedicated car mount for your iPad to access navigation apps like Google Maps or Waze while driving.
- Keep your iPhone connected to CarPlay in your vehicle for seamless music streaming, calls, and messaging.
- Watch for updates about any future announcements from Apple regarding potential iPad compatibility with CarPlay.
Although a direct connection isn't currently available, these methods can still help you enjoy a secure driving experience.
